Shawnee Peak Terrain

With the most night skiing in New England, Shawnee Peak is known for customer service, family friendly programs, great snow conditions and unparalleled value.
Check out the panoramic vistas with the White Mountains, Presidential Mountain Range, Lakes Region and you can even see the ocean on a clear day!
In the morning, head over to the East Area - the sun makes it's first appearance here, warming up the snow and the skiers for an unmatched morning experience.

After lunch, cruise Lower Kancamangus, Fat and Happy and the East Slope Area. Snow is still groomed and polished for that first tracks feeling! Beginners have the whole west side of the mountain to themselves! In fact, more than 40 acres are dedicated to beginner/novice skiers and riders!

Shawnee Peak Snowboarding

Halfpipes: 0
Tarrain Parks: 2

All trails, Freestyle terrain park, Grommet Garden for beginners. Two Lit Freestyle Terrain Parks for nighttime skiing and riding. Check out the new 12' x 20' Wall Ride! 12' high by 20' wide, this feature is the focal point of the Freestyle Terrain Park. What's New This Season at Shawnee Peak

$1 Million in Mountain Improvements!
New Summit Triple Express! Bigger and Faster than the old Triple, giving you more runs per day than ever before!
Emmegi Conveyor Loading System - Located at the bottom of the Summit Triple, this new system makes loading the lift easier than ever! Step on the new conveyor and the chair will whisk you up the mountain!
Snowmaking on Sunset Blvd! Everyone's favorite new trail has been upgraded for even more skiing and riding!
